Prominent among the spore-propagated plants are _ferns_. The common
_Christmas fern_ (so called because it remains green during winter)
is shown in Fig. 254. The plant has no trunk. The leaves spring
directly from the ground. The leaves of ferns are called =fronds=.
They vary in shape, as other leaves do. Some of the fronds in Fig.
254 are seen to be narrower at the top. If these are examined more
closely (Fig. 255), it will be seen that the leaflets are contracted
and are densely covered beneath with brown bodies. These bodies are
collections of =sporangia= or =spore-cases=.

The sporangia are collected into little groups, known as =sori=
(singular, sorus) or =fruit-dots=. Each sorus is covered with a thin
scale or shield, known as an =indusium=. This indusium separates from
the frond at its edges, and the sporangia are exposed. Not all ferns
have indusia. The polypode (Figs. 256, 257) does not; the sori are
naked. In the brake (Fig. 258) and maidenhair (Fig. 259) the edge
of the frond turns over and forms an indusium. The nephrolepis or
sword fern of greenhouses is allied to the polypode. The sori are
in a single row on either side the midrib (Fig. 260). The indusium
is circular or kidney-shaped and open at one edge or finally all
around. The Boston fern, Washington fern, Pierson fern, and others,
are horticultural forms of the common sword fern. In some ferns (Fig.
261) an entire frond becomes contracted to cover the sporangia.

The sporangium or spore-case of a fern is a more or less globular
body and usually with a stalk (Fig. 257). _It contains the spores.
When ripe it bursts and the spores are set free._

In a moist, warm place _the spores germinate_. They produce a small,
flat, thin, green, more or less heart-shaped membrane (Fig. 262).
This is the =prothallus=. Sometimes the prothallus is an inch or
more across, but oftener it is less than a ten cent piece in size.
Although easily seen, it is commonly unknown except to botanists.
Prothalli may often be found in greenhouses where ferns are grown.
Look on the moist stone or brick walls, or on the firm soil of
undisturbed pots and beds; or spores may be sown in a damp, warm
place.
